Quote:
Modern drive heads park as they are powered down now. No need to command the park to take place.


Right, which is why I said "was desirable". Hypex said he use to park his heads every time he turned off his Amiga. I was just pointing out that there was no need unless the drive was being moved.

Of course nowadays modern drivers park their own heads - been that way for a LONG time.
